Hi everyone,

I just updated the prettyPhoto Stack to the latest and greatest version so far: prettyPhoto 3.0.

In this new version, you can play slideshows inside the lightbox, include navigation thumbnails, and have more control over the styling of your lightbox by selecting the font size and color of the description and navigation text.

In addition, prettyPhoto now supports Vimeo's new universal player to play Vimeo files on your iPhone and iPad.

Of course, it's a free update and buyers should be getting new download links as we speak...

You can check some demos on my website as well as the new user interface.

I hope you enjoy this exciting new version!

    Thanks Mauricio. Just for clarification, the was a 'prettyPhoto Extensions' stack that shipped with the early versions. Is this now obsolete?

    Yes, I pulled out the Extensions stack soon after I released it because it was not working properly with Internet Explorer.

    After that, I released a version that incorporated Flowplayer to handle videos in mp4, m4v, and flv format (in part, that was the intended purpose of the Extensions stack...)

    Please get rid of the pP Extensions stack...
